
Private Airport Transfers in Tashkent
Tashkent is Uzbekistan's capital and the Central Asian city with the largest airport network — Tashkent International (TAS) is 15 kilometres south-east of the centre and handles Uzbekistan Airways' main hub operations plus regional and long-haul carriers. Transfer times into central Tashkent are 25 to 40 minutes depending on Amir Timur highway traffic. The city itself mixes Soviet-era planning with new post-2016 monument redevelopment — Khast Imom religious complex, the spice and produce stalls of Chorsu Bazaar, the ornate Tashkent Metro with its themed stations — and is the natural start or end of any Silk Road itinerary. Key Destinations from TAS
Tashkent city centre (Amir Timur Square): 15 km, 25–40 min. Chorsu Bazaar and old city: 12 km, 25–40 min. Khast Imom religious complex: 14 km, 25–40 min. Hotel Uzbekistan and Mustaqillik Maydoni: 13 km, 25–40 min. Tashkent Railway Station (for Afrosiyob to Samarkand): 13 km, 25–40 min. Mirzo Ulugbek district: 10 km, 20–30 min. Chorvoq reservoir (weekend escape): 80 km, 1.5–2 hours.
